To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department how many racially motivated attacks are estimated to have taken place within the Greater London area in each of the last 12 months. [31699]
The information requested has been provided by the Commissioner of Police of the Metropolis and is contained in the table. The data supplied relate to the number of racially motivated incidents as per the Association of Chief Police Officers definition and excludes the City of London.
Racial incident figures: Metropolitan Police District 1 April 1994–31 March 1995

Month
| Number of racial incidents
|
April 1994 | 478 |
May | 443 |
June | 509 |
July | 557 |
August | 558 |
September | 517 |
October | 454 |
November | 461 |
December | 384 |
January 1995 | 379 |
February | 379 |
March | 361 |
Total 1994–95 | 5,480 |
Association of Chief Police Officers definition: Any incident in which it appears to the reporting or investigative officer that the complaint involves an element of racial motive, or any incidents which include allegations of racial motivation made by any person.
